Micropower, Rail to Rail Input Current Sense Amplifier with
Voltage Output
ISL28006
The ISL28006 is a micropower, uni-directional high-side and
low-side current sense amplifier featuring a proprietary
rail-to-rail input current sensing amplifier. The ISL28006 is
ideal for high-side current sense applications where the sense
voltage is usually much higher than the amplifier supply
voltage. The device can be used to sense voltages as high as
28V when operating from a supply voltage as low as 2.7V. The
micropower ISL28006 consumes only 50µA of supply current
when operating from a 2.7V to 28V supply.
The ISL28006 features a common-mode input voltage range
from 0V to 28V. The proprietary architecture extends the input
voltage sensing range down to 0V, making it an excellent
choice for low-side ground sensing applications. The benefit of
this architecture is that a high degree of total output accuracy
is maintained over the entire 0V to 28V common mode input
voltage range.
The ISL28006 is available in fixed (100V/V, 50V/V, 20V/V and
Adjustable) gains in the space saving 5 Ld SOT-23 package
and the 6 Ld SOT-23 package for the adjustable gain part. The
parts operate over the extended temperature range from
-40°C to +125°C.

Applications Information
Functional Description
The ISL28006-20, ISL28006-50 and ISL28006-100 are single
supply, uni-directional current sense amplifiers with fixed gains
of 20V/V, 50V/V and 100V/V respectively. The ISL28006-ADJ is
single supply, uni-directional current sense amplifier with an
adjustable gain via external resistors (see Figure 72). The
ISL28006-ADJ is stable for gains of 20 and higher.
The ISL28006 is a 2-stage amplifier. Figure 68 shows the active
circuitry for high-side current sense applications where the sense
voltage is between 1.35V to 28V. Figure 69 shows the active
circuitry for ground sense applications where the sense voltage is
between 0V to 1.35V.
The first stage is a bi-level trans-conductance amp and level
translator. The gm stage converts the low voltage drop (VSENSE)
sensed across an external milli-ohm sense resistor, to a current
(@ gm = 21.3µA/V). The trans-conductance amplifier forces a
current through R1 resulting to a voltage drop across R1 that is
equal to the sense voltage (VSENSE). The current through R1 is
mirrored across R5 creating a ground-referenced voltage at the
input of the second amplifier equal to VSENSE.
The second stage is responsible for the overall gain and
frequency response performance of the device. The fixed gains
(20, 50, 100) are set with internal resistors Rf and Rg. The
variable gain (ADJ) has an additional FB pin and uses external
gain resistors to set the gain of the output. For the fixed gain
amps the only external component needed is a current sense
resistor (typically 0.001 to 0.01, 1W to 2W).
The transfer function for the fixed gain parts is given in
Equation 1.
The transfer function for the adjustable gain part is given in
Equation 2.
The input gm stage derives its ~2.86µA supply current from the
input source through the RS+ terminal as long as the sensed
voltage at the RS+ pin is >1.35V and the gmHI amplifier is
selected. When the sense voltage at RS+ drops below the 1.35V
threshold, the gmLO amplifier kicks in and the gmLO output
current reverses, flowing out of the RS- pin.

Hysteretic Comparator
The input trans-conductance amps are under control of a
hysteretic comparator operating from the incoming source
voltage on the RS+ pin (Figure 68). The comparator monitors the
voltage on RS+ and switches the sense amplifier from the
low-side gm amp to the high-side gm amplifier whenever the
input voltage at RS+ increases above the 1.35V threshold.
Conversely, a decreasing voltage on the RS+ pin, causes the
hysteric comparator to switch from the high-side gm amp to the
low-side gm amp as the voltage decreases below 1.35V. It is that
low-side sense gm amplifier that gives the ISL28006 the
proprietary ability to sense current all the way to 0V. Negative
voltages on the RS+ or RS- are beyond the sensing voltage range
of this amplifier.
Typical Application Circuit
Figure 72 shows the basic application circuit and optional
protection components for switched-load applications. For
applications where the load and the power source is permanently
connected, only an external sense resistor is needed. For
applications where fast transients are caused by hot plugging the
source or load, external protection components may be needed.
The external current limiting resistor (RP) in Figure 72 may be
required to limit the peak current through the internal ESD
diodes to <20mA. This condition can occur in applications that
experience high levels of in-rush current causing high peak
voltages that can damage the internal ESD diodes. An RP resistor
value of 100 will provide protection for a 2V transient with the
maximum of 20mA flowing through the input while adding only
an additional 13µV (worse case over-temperature) of VOS. Refer
to Equation 3:
Switching applications can generate voltage spikes that can
overdrive the amplifier input and drive the output of the amplifier
into the rails, resulting in a long overload recover time.
Capacitors CM and CD filter the common mode and differential
voltage spikes.
Error Sources
There are 3 dominant error sources: gain error, input offset
voltage error and Kelvin voltage error (see Figure 71). The gain
error is dominated by the internal resistance matching
tolerances. The remaining errors appear as sense voltage errors
at the input to the amplifier. They are VOS of the amplifier and
Kelvin voltage errors. If the transient protection resistor is added,
an additional VOS error can result from the IxR voltage due to
input bias current. The limiting resistor should only be added to
the RS- input, due to the high-side gm amplifier (gmHI) sinking
several micro amps of current through the RS+ pin.
Layout Guidelines
The Kelvin Connected Sense Resistor
The source of Kelvin voltage errors is illustrated in Figure 71. The
resistance of 1/2 Oz copper is ~1m per square with a TC of
~3900ppm/°C (0.39%/°C). When you compare this unwanted
parasitic resistance with the total 1m to 10m resistance of
the sense resistor, it is easy to see why the sense connection
must be chosen very carefully. For example, consider a
maximum current of 20A through a 0.005 sense resistor,
generating a VSENSE = 0.1 and a full scale output voltage of 10V
(G = 100). Two side contacts of only 0.25 square per contact puts
the VSENSE input about 0.5 x 1m away from the resistor end
capacitor. If only 10A the 20A total current flows through the
kelvin path to the resistor, you get an error voltage of 10mV
(10A x 0.5sq x 0.001/sq. = 10mV) added to the 100mV sense
voltage for a sense voltage error of 10% (0.110V-0.1)/0.1V) x 100.

Overall Accuracy (VOA %)
VOA is defined as the total output accuracy Referred-to-Output
(RTO). The output accuracy contains all offset and gain errors, at
a single output voltage. Equation 4 is used to calculate the %
total output accuracy.
where
VOUT Actual = VSENSE x GAIN
Example: Gain = 100, For 100mV VSENSE input we measure
10.1V. The overall accuracy (VOA) is 1% as shown in Equation 5.
Power Dissipation
It is possible to exceed the +150°C maximum junction
temperatures under certain load and power supply conditions. It
is therefore important to calculate the maximum junction
temperature (TJMAX) for all applications to determine if power
supply voltages, load conditions, or package type need to be
modified to remain in the safe operating area. These parameters
are related using Equation 6:
